What's Happening?
Hyundai Motor Group is making strides in the field of electrified mobility, focusing on advanced research and development at its Namyang R&D Center in South Korea. The company is working on optimizing aerodynamic efficiency to enhance the performance and range of its electric vehicles (EVs). Hyundai's efforts include the development of the 'Aero Challenge Car,' a research prototype that explores next-generation aerodynamic solutions. The prototype features active aerodynamic technologies designed to reduce drag and improve efficiency. These innovations, while not yet production-ready, indicate Hyundai's commitment to pushing the boundaries of EV design.
